DEDE63 NXP Semiconductors Germany GmbH

Working Student Embedded Control(m/w/x)

München
Part-timeWorking StudentWith Home Office

Porting next-gen control algorithms to embedded hardware for robotics. Real-time embedded development with C/C++ and motor-control peripherals required. 30 vacation days, hybrid work.

Requirements

  • Enrolled student in Electrical Engineering or related field
  • Good knowledge of embedded programming and debugging on MCUs/MPUs
  • Experience with real-time embedded development (C/C++)
  • Experience with motor-control peripherals, timers, PWM, and low-latency ISR design
  • Knowledge of electric machines, power electronics, and/or electric-drive modeling and control
  • Motivation to learn electric-drive use cases
  • FOC for BLDC/PMSM based Servos and observer design for sensorless estimation
  • Understanding of GaN vs. silicon MOSFETs
  • Familiarity with motor drivers and current/voltage sensing
  • Availability to work onsite in Munich lab
  • Comfortable and motivated to support development of research and simulation test setup
  • Motivation to work across electrical, mechanical, and software components
  • Exposure to Python advantageous
  • Exposure to Hardware-in-the-Loop (HiL) environments advantageous
  • Exposure to ROS2/Gazebo advantageous
  • Fluent in English, spoken and written
  • Responsibility for security related tasks
  • Conscious and reliable way of working necessary for security certifications

Tasks

  • Port next-generation control algorithms to embedded hardware
  • Connect and integrate various sensors, data sources, and communication devices into embedded setups
  • Perform physical integration of sensors, data sources, and communication devices
  • Handle firmware integration for sensors, data sources, and communication devices
  • Support engineers in evaluating control algorithms through simulation
  • Assist engineers in evaluating control algorithms through emulation
  • Help engineers evaluate control algorithms using hardware testing
